Sump Pump Plumbing in Warwick, RI
Sump pump plumbing services focus on installing, repairing, and maintaining sump pump systems that help protect properties from flooding and water damage. These systems are typically installed in basements or crawl spaces and work by removing excess water that accumulates due to heavy rain, melting snow, or groundwater seepage. Projects may include upgrading an existing sump pump, replacing a failed unit, or installing a new system to ensure reliable operation during storms. Homeowners often want to understand the capacity of the pump, how it connects to drainage systems, and what maintenance is needed to keep it functioning properly over time.
Before requesting sump pump plumbing services, property owners should consider the size and layout of their property, as well as the specific water issues they face. It’s important to determine whether a standard sump pump is sufficient or if a specialized system is needed for high water tables or frequent flooding. Understanding the location of the sump basin, the power source, and any backup options can also influence the choice of system. Clear communication about these factors helps ensure the installation or repairs meet the property’s needs and provide long-term protection against water intrusion.

Sump Pump Plumbing Questions
What is a sump pump? A sump pump is a device installed in a basement or crawl space to remove excess water and prevent flooding during heavy rains or groundwater seepage.
When should a sump pump be replaced? Replacement is recommended if the pump frequently fails, makes unusual noises, or shows signs of rust and corrosion.
What are common signs of sump pump failure? Signs include water pooling in the basement, the pump running constantly, or it cycling on and off unexpectedly.
How does a sump pump connect to plumbing? It is connected to a drain or discharge pipe that directs water away from the property to prevent pooling or flooding.
